Firefox Environment Backup Extension

Firefox Environment Backup Extension (or FEBE) is a Pale Moon browser extension for backing up and restoring user profiles.[1] It was compatible with Firefox version 1.5 - 57-pre.[2][3] However, Firefox profiles may be backed up manually.[4] The source files are distributed under MPL-2.0.

Among other settings, it handles bookmarks, history, extensions and passwords.[5] The extension offers several configuration options to customize the backup tasks, and can also do scheduled backups.[6]
